Common Residential & Commercial Roofing Scams in Waterville

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Storm Chaser Scam

Fly-by-night crews knock after wind or hail, claim 'urgent damage,' push cheap fixes, take a fat deposit, then ghost you.

🚫

Upfront Payment Grab

Contractor insists on 50%+ cash/wire deposit before starting, does shoddy work or vanishes midway.

🚫

Bait-and-Switch Materials

Quotes premium shingles low, then 'oops, out of stock'—swaps cheap crap, bills extra.

🚫

Fake Damage Push

Exaggerates minor issues to file big insurance claims, pockets the difference or skips proper repairs.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Request a Certificate of Insurance (COI) for general liability ($1M+ coverage) and workers' comp. Call the insurer listed on the COI to confirm it's current and valid.

2

Licensing

Washington requires roofing contractors to be licensed by the Department of Labor & Industries (L&I). Verify at secure.lni.wa.gov/verify using the license number or business name. Check for active status and roofing specialty.

3

References

Ask for 3+ recent local references in Douglas County or nearby. Call them to verify work quality, completion on time, and fair pricing—no leading questions.

Protection FAQs

How do I check a roofer's license in Washington?

Go to the WA L&I site: secure.lni.wa.gov/verify. Search by license # or name. Confirm active and roofing-endorsed.

Is a deposit normal for roofing jobs?

Yes, but small (10% max) after contract signing. Avoid cash/wire. Pay progress payments tied to milestones.

What scams hit after storms in Waterville?

Storm chasers door-knocking for quick cash deposits. Hold off—verify licenses and get competing bids.

Does my roofer need insurance?

Absolutely. Liability protects your property; workers' comp covers injuries. Verify COI directly.

Should I get multiple roofing quotes?

Yes, 3+ from verified pros. Compare apples-to-apples on scope, materials, and total cost.

Who handles roofing permits in Douglas County?

Trustworthy roofers pull them via county building dept. Ask to see permit # before work starts.
